Methyl Isovalerate exists as a transparent liquid substance which has a strong fruity scent. The chemical serves two main purposes in industry because it functions as a flavoring substance in food products and beverages and as a fragrance component in cosmetics. The pharmaceutical industry depends on Methyl Isovalerate to produce different medications through its role as a critical synthesis intermediate.
